Kushinara Incoming Packet Monitor 0.5
Incoming is a packet monitor designed to monitor SYN packets. Machines receive SYN packets when a remote machine is trying to initiate a TCP connection.

When a machine is listening on a port, it replies the machine sending the SYN packet with an aknowledgement ( ACK ) request. If the machine is not listening on a particular port, then the machine will reply with a reset ( RST ) request.

Many crackers use the SYN scan technique to detect open ports. This helps the crackers easily detect the services running on a machine.

Incoming is a utility designed to closely monitor the SYN packets being received by a machine. This can be of great help to machines that act as servers on the internet, or machines that are directly connected to the internet through a broadband connection.
